Australia Test squad member Josh Inglis has been released to play in the BBL for Perth Scorchers and is set to be named in their squad to face Hobart Hurricanes on Saturday in Hobart.
ESPNcricinfo understands that Inglis flew from Brisbane to Hobart on Thursday and will be included in Scorchers' squad tomorrow, having stayed with Australia's squad for the entire third Test where he sub fielded for most of India's first innings in place of the injured Josh Hazlewood.
Australia are still to announce their squad for the final two Tests but Scorchers' next two matches fit in nicely with the schedule. Scorchers play in Hobart on Saturday then in Melbourne against Renegades on Monday night. That will be the same day as Australia's first optional training session in Melbourne ahead of the Boxing Day Test with their main session to be held on Tuesday. It could give Inglis the chance to play some further cricket after he was retained with Australia's squad for their BBL opener against Melbourne Stars while fellow Test squad member Beau Webster was released to play in Perth.

Brisbane Heat's stand-in skipper and marquee overseas signing Colin Munro is touch and go for the defending champions' season opener against Melbourne Stars while Spencer Johnson is unlikely to play before Christmas and Michael Neser will remain on the sidelines until January.
Heat released their 14-man squad for their opening BBL match at the MCG on Wednesday night with Munro named to captain under new coach Johan Botha while permanent skipper Usman Khawaja is away on Test duty.
But Munro reported tightness in his hamstring at training on Tuesday afternoon and a decision will be made on game day as to whether he takes his place. If he is not passed fit, Queensland vice-captain Mitchell Swepson is likely to lead the team with last summer's title-winning stand-in captain Nathan McSweeney also on Test duty.

Melbourne Stars have signed Blake Macdonald as a local replacement player for Glenn Maxwell.
Maxwell has been sidelined from the early stages of the BBL due to the hamstring injury he picked up against Pakistan in the T20I series last month.
Macdonald, who plays for New South Wales in state cricket, recently featured for Victoria in the Global Super League in Guyana and scored 133 at the weekend for St Kilda Cricket Club.

Quick bowler Brendan Doggett has been released from Australia's Test squad to be available for Adelaide Strikers in the opening week of the BBL.
Doggett was called up to the squad ahead of the second Test against India after Josh Hazlewood suffered a side strain and remained with the group for Brisbane.
However, he was not expected to feature in Strikers' opening game against Sydney Thunder in Canberra on Tuesday. He only played one game for Strikers last season.
